dnata Catering U.S. is a segment of dnata, one of the world’s largest and most respected air services providers. Established in 1959, dnata operates a vast global network offering ground handling, cargo, travel, and in-flight catering services across 127 airports in 35 countries across six continents. With a trusted partnership serving over 300 airline customers worldwide, the company handles more than 1,900 flights daily, moves vast quantities of cargo, books thousands of hotel stays, and uplifts hundreds of thousands of meals every day. dnata Catering U.S. is actively seeking talented individuals to join its San Francisco team supporting operations at... Job Duties
- follow up with the proper department to ensure all open issues are resolved
- ensure that the day-to-day operation is on schedule, using the proper and most updated documentation
- liaise with the local customer station team and follow up on all local operational related issues
- maintain an on-going proactive relationship with assigned accounts and maintaining a dialog with assigned representatives
- ensure equipment inventories are taken and communicated to appropriate personnel on time according to the customer schedules
- support the executive chef in coordinating menu presentations and any special presentations
- support the production department with all airline cycle changes, including holding menu meetings and coordinating purchases with the buyer
- monitor and ensure that loading and billing of the customer is accurate
- coordinate and participate in all kitchen evaluations and distribute evaluation feedback to department managers
- communicate daily with department managers regarding operational issues and attend daily operations briefing
- document and maintain a daily customer discrepancy log and communicate information to respective department managers
- monitor and ensure compliance with customer safety and equipment policies and procedures
